Warning Signs You Need Under Sink Water Extraction in Elyria, OH
Ignoring water damage can lead to costly repairs and potential health hazards. Here are some warning signs that you need under sink water extraction: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
If you notice a musty smell coming from your under sink area, it’s a sign that water has seeped into the wood or drywall and created an ideal environment for mold and mildew growth.
Water Stains on the Ceiling or Walls
If you notice water stains on your ceiling or walls, it’s a sign that water is leaking from your under sink area and needs to be extracted.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
If your flooring starts to warp or buckle, it’s a sign that water has seeped into the subfloor and needs to be extracted before it causes further damage.
Soggy Carpet or Pad
If your carpet or pad is soggy or spongy, it’s a sign that water has seeped into the underlayment and needs to be extracted.
Water Droplets on the Floor or Walls
If you notice water droplets on your floor or walls, it’s a sign that water is leaking from your under sink area and needs to be extracted.
Cracked or Broken Tiles
If your tiles are cracked or broken, it’s a sign that water has seeped into the grout or caulk and needs to be extracted.
Under Sink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water leak (less than 1 gallon) | Yes | No | You can likely handle a small water leak on your own with a towel or wet/dry vacuum. |
| Medium-sized water leak (1-5 gallons) | No | Yes | A medium-sized water leak needs specialized equipment and expertise to extract the water and prevent further damage. |
| Large water leak (more than 5 gallons) | No | Yes | A large water leak needs immediate attention from a professional water removal service to prevent further damage and potential health hazards. |
| Water damage with visible mold or mildew | No | Yes | Mold and mildew need specialized equipment and techniques to remove safely and effectively. |
| Water damage with electrical parts affected | No | Yes | Water and electricity can be a deadly combination, call a professional to ensure your safety. |
| Water damage with structural parts affected | No | Yes | Water damage to structural parts needs immediate attention from a professional to prevent further damage and potential collapse. |

Under Sink Water Extraction Cost in Elyria, OH
The cost of under sink water ext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Elyria, OH.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Drying and d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Sanitizing and disinfecting |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area and type of sanitizing agents required. |
| Repair and re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Scope of work, materials needed, and labor costs. |
| Flood cleanup |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Debris removal | $100 – $500 | Size of debris and equipment needed. |
